A base class for processing systems. A processor is an platform part implements the 'behavior' of a platform. It can represent either a human or a machine.
Processors are invoked by one of two methods:
A process can do just about anything it wants, i.e.: invoke actions, update platform objects, send messages (to other processors or platforms).

Perform phase 1 initialization of the part. This is invoked by WsfPlatform::Initialize() during phase 1 initialization of the platform. During phase 1 initialization, platform components must not assume the existence of ANY data that is the responsibility of another platform component. In particular, the platform location and initial tracks cannot be assumed to be valid.

Perform phase 2 initialization of the part. This is invoked by WsfPlatform::Initialize() during phase 2 initialization of the platform. During phase 2, platform components may assume that the platform location has been defined, initial tracks have been loaded and that all components have completed phase 1 initialization.

Perform pre-initializion function. This is called by WsfPlatform::Initialize prior to actually initializing the components on a platform (i.e.: calling Initialize and Initialize2 for each component). The primary reason for this method is to allow components to add other components that will then be subsequently initialized. The component may examine the component list and add components, but it must not assume ANYTHING about the actual state of the component.

Perform pre-input processing. This is called in certain contexts just before input processing is FIRST done for a component (See WsfObjectTypeListBase::LoadComponentP.) The primary motivation is to allow the newly created component to invoke the type/role-specific PreInput method in the component factories, which may in turn add any sub-components that MAY be required for input processing or for run-time.
This is currently implemented only for platform level components such as WsfComm, WsfProcessor, WsfSensor and some components implemented in optional projects. You can look at the PreInput methods in each of these and see they are very simple.
The reason for this is that WsfObjectTypeListBase::LoadComponentP cannot simply invoke the PreInput methods in the component factories. PreInput is only defined in the template WsfComponentFactoryT<>, and the PreInput method in the template defines a method whose argument is a reference to the object being created. There is no way for LoadComponentP to do this in general. Delegating it to to component solves the problem.
